The members applying under ICSI – eCSin Amnesty Scheme, 2022 shall be granted immunity from the applicability of the provisions of the eCSin Guidelines, 2019 in respect of the eCSin for which request under this Amnesty Scheme has been made and disciplinary proceedings shall not be initiated entertained in this respect.

Any CS student after passing Final Examination or Professional Programme, who claims to have acquired practical knowledge and skills equivalent for Practical training (including EDP) stated in regulation 46BB, may apply for exemption from undergoing practical training (including EDP) in accordance with the criteria laid down in these guidelines.
All students who have completed their final/professional examination of the ICSI, but could not undergo practical training due to their job constraints and were therefore unable to become the Member of the Institute, can apply for exemption from practical training on the basis of their work experience provided that the applicant is eligible for granting exemption from training as per the requirement of the Company Secretaries Regulations, 1982
